Entries now open for Flint Group’s 12th Narrow Web Print Awards

Flint Group Narrow Web has officially opened the 12th annual Narrow Web Print Awards competition with its first call for entries. Label converters from around the globe are encouraged to submit sample labels of their choosing for evaluation by a panel of industry judges.

The winners of this prestigious award will be announced during a live event at the Flint Group stand at Labelexpo Americas in Chicago, USA, on September 14, 2016. The company will unveil the names of those printers whose submissions exemplify excellence and entrepreneurship in this wide world of narrow web printing.

Flint Group is challenging converters to ‘think outside the label’ and to also submit their best prints in the Flexible Packaging and Shrink Sleeve segments.

Niklas Olsson, global brand manager, commented: “We encourage printers to demonstrate the enriched and expanding pallet of applications that are possible using narrow web presses, utilising any print method of their choice – water-based flexo, UV flexo, UV offset, or a combination thereof.

“Over the past two years we have seen an increased amount of print submissions coming from other market segments – it’s encouraging to see narrow web grow in pressure sensitive label, but even more so into various segments of the flexible packaging market and shrink sleeves.”

Kelly Kolliopoulos, global marketing director narrow web, added: “In 2016, we will have a special award dedicated to LED UV printing. For this, we ask pioneers of the industry to come forward and provide examples of LED UV print. As this technology expands, the market is seeing true benefits and outstanding print results – and the market is growing! We would like to bring special attention to printers who have taken this first step, with LED UV, into the future.”

Flint Group has received hundreds of submissions since the first competition in 2005; presenting this prestigious award to more than 75 companies globally. In 2015, Flint Group presented awards in 13 different categories at Labelexpo Europe – all submissions using inks, coatings, and specialty products that were supplied by Flint Group Narrow Web.

Criteria for this year’s judging includes: registration, smoothness of dot/vignette, overall print quality, and degree of difficulty. Entries will be placed in categories relating to technology and application. Award winners will be announced at the Flint Group booth at Labelexpo Americas in September.
